Can anyone please help?
I try to access system information and nothing is displayed.
I have installed SP2 but not sure when this problem occured.
Computer doesn't state a problem
I have tried run msinfo32exe and the file is showing at correct location etc
it just won't show me what is going on.
Any ideas guys?????
Thanks.

Go to Start/Run and type in: winmsd
Verify your settings here: Start/Run/Regedit
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Shared Tools\MSInfo
Path value = C:\Program Files\Common Files\Microsoft
Shared\MSInfo\msinfo32.exe
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\App
Paths\msinfo32.exe
Default value = C:\Program Files\Common Files\Microsoft
Shared\MSInfo\MSInfo32.exe
Path value = C:\Program Files\Common Files\Microsoft Shared\MSInfo

Fix for Help and Support and System Information
http://www.dougknox.com/xp/scripts_desc/fixwinxphelp.htm

Go to Start/Run/CMD and type in: net stop winmgmt. Then delete the
System32\wbem\repository directory. Once done go back to Start/Run/CMD and
type in: net start winmgmt.

Error Message: Windows Management Instrumentation (WMI) Might Be Corrupted
(Unable to view System Information (MSinfo32)
http://support.microsoft.com/default.aspx?scid=kb;en-us;319101

How to Use System Information (MSINFO32) Switches
http://support.microsoft.com/default.aspx?scid=KB;EN-US;q300887&

If none of the above helps, replace your Boot.ini.
